Your Property Has A Story. We Help You Document It.

Most property owners rely on memory when trying to recall maintenance history, past concerns, or changes in property condition.

The Home Health Report™ creates a documented record of observations, maintenance activities, photographs, and recommendations over time, helping owners better understand the condition and performance of their property.

Report scope: The Home Health Report™ is not a licensed home inspection report and does not replace specialized evaluations from licensed contractors, home inspectors, engineers, electricians, plumbers, HVAC contractors, roofers, or other trade professionals. First Due Home Safety is maintenance-focused, observational, and documentation-based.
